I'm using Debian GNU/Linux 8 (jessie). I've just noticed that there's always a root console open on tty9 on my laptop after booting. Is this normal or should I worry?
I've looked around on the web for information but haven't found anything useful about this. Last time I poked around for this sort of thing on a computer I'd have looked in places like /etc/inittab, but now it seems that things have moved on from sysvinit to systemd, and I've no idea where to look now. If it's any help: I'm running without a desktop environment, just booting to a console and starting X with stumpwm manually. Thanks in advance. Yours sincerely, -- Jim Ottaway
